Does anyone know of where I might be able to locate a recording of a 
Long-eared Owl, in particular a contact or alarm call?   Anyone have any 
suggestions as to what may be making a call I've heard 3 times in the last 
week around my house?  I live just off Beulah Rd near Manchester Lakes 
shopping center in Alexandria, VA.  This call is a raspy bark-like sound 
(very similar to the Short-eared Owl calls I've heard at Bombay Hook), 
repeated 3 times in a series.  I've heard it between 10:30 and 11:30 at 
night.  Sounds vaguely like a Green Heron squawk or Pheasant, only not as 
loud, raspy, or as long.
